A vertically oriented religious panel painting, encased in a simple light-colored wooden frame, is displayed on a plain gray wall in what appears to be a museum or gallery in Amsterdam, Netherlands.

The painting depicts multiple figures against a blue background adorned with small, light-colored motifs. At the top, a male figure with a golden halo and beard, wearing a white garment over darker clothing, stands prominently. Below him, a procession-like arrangement of several other male figures follows, each with individual attire and some with hats. These figures appear to be standing on a narrow strip of green and brown ground at the bottom of the painted scene. At the very bottom of the panel, a female figure with a halo, dressed in a flowing red gown, is depicted holding an infant, who also has a halo, suggesting a Madonna and Child motif.

The artwork exhibits characteristics of an older style, possibly medieval or early Renaissance, with visible crackling and wear on its surface. The painting is well-lit by an unseen light source from the left, casting a subtle shadow on the wall behind the frame. Directly below the painting, a small rectangular information plaque with illegible text provides details about the artwork. The scene is static, capturing the art piece on display within its institutional setting.
